April 11th: Proper body position, balance, and hip roll. Year round swimmer technique vs. Triathletes, preventing swimmers shoulder through rotator cuff stability exercises. April 18th: Arm recovery and entry, dryland exercises for swimming, and introduction to sculling and feel for the water. May 2nd: Catch and pull, general workout guidelines, and discussion of swim equipment May 16th: Snap and power, open water swimming skills, and race preparation.

Up to 80% of the resistance you encounter on the bike comes from aerodynamic drag. Reducing this wind resistance is a key consideration in increasing speed. The more upright your riding position, the more aerodynamic drag you create. By lowering your torso towards the top tube, you essentially "get under the wind" by reducing your aerodynamic profile. | Can Too Much Exercise Make You Sick? |
A common perception exists that overtraining or participation in lengthy endurance type events will cause athletes to become ill. In fact, results from a survey conducted by the Gatorade Sports Science Institute show that nearly 90 percent of 2,700 high school and collegiate coaches and athletic trainers believe that overtraining can compromise the immune system and make athletes sick.
